MIDDLEBURY, Ind. – Grand Design Recreational Vehicles hosted its second annual ‘Christmas in July’ event as a toy drive for the U.S. Marine Corps Reserve Toys for Tots program. The goal of the event was to fill the Momentum toy hauler on-site with donations and it was a huge success. In total, the event filled 29 Toys for Tots boxes and received 8 bikes. They also have $500 to purchase additional items.

The toy drive was held from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. EST on July 22 at Grand Design RV’s customer service and support center, located at 5200 Hoffman St., in Elkhart, Ind. Food trucks were on-site along with a Momentum unit from Grand Design RV and a Dutch Star unit patrons were able to tour from Winnebago sister company Newmar Corporation.

Grand Design created a Christmas in July Amazon Buyers Guide and saw everything on the list sell out due to online donations from local community members and RV owners from around the country. Grand Design then created a second Amazon list of items to meet the demand from the community that is still active. All the toys donated will directly benefit children in Elkhart County and the surrounding area.

“We have had great success and we have a wonderful partnership with the Marine Corps of Elkhart area, and we want to be able to do anything we can to help provide more to the community with this Toys for Tots program,” according to Emily Stahley, Grand Design’s director of community and owner outreach. “Doing something in July allows us to give them a little bit of a boost for their December drive. It gets them started so they know exactly what they’re looking for, come December.

“We’ve had a successful event with the community and we’ve had more community members come out this week or this time, than we did last year,” she added. “We also had Newmar come in and they brought a whole mess of toys. They went shopping with the over $5,000 worth of money that they were able to raise over two days, as well. We are so thankful for Chelsea and her crew over at Newmar.”

Since 1947, the Toys for Tots program has assisted over 272 million children. The Marine Toys for Tots Foundation is a not-for-profit organization authorized by the U.S. Marine Corps and the Department of Defense to provide fundraising and other necessary support for the program.
